h3.box, .box {font-size:1rem; line-height:100%;}
.parrilla_head .secmod .title h2 {font-family:Roboto, arial,sans-serif;font-size:200%; color:#4b4b4b; line-height:180%; width:auto; border-bottom:1px solid #ccc;position:relative;font-family:"RTVEfontR","Arial Narrow",sans-serif;letter-spacing:0 !important;display:inline-block;padding: 1rem 2rem;font-size: 3rem;}

.parrilla_head .nav ul.days {float:left;line-height: 3.5rem; margin-right:.3rem; position:relative; left:0;}
.parrilla_head .nav ul.hour {float:left;line-height: 3.5rem;}

.parrilla_bottom .nav .viewall a:hover {background: #d81a28;color:#fff;}
.parrilla_head .nav ul.days li, .parrilla_head .nav ul.hour li{display:inline; font-size:110%; color:#4b4b4b; font-weight:bold; text-transform:uppercase;}
.parrilla_head .nav ul.days li a, .parrilla_head .nav ul.hour li a,  .parrilla_head .nav .viewall a {transition:all .2s; padding:.5rem 1.5rem; background-color:#fff; color:#4b4b4b;border-bottom:.1rem solid #ccc;font-family: Roboto, arial,sans-serif;text-decoration: none;}
.parrilla_head .nav ul.days li a:hover, .parrilla_head .nav ul.hour li a:hover,  .parrilla_head .nav .viewall a:hover {padding: .5rem 1.5rem;background-color:#d81a28;color:#fff!important;border-color:#821119;}
.parrilla_head .nav .selbox {clear:both;border:1px solid #b8b8b8; border-bottom:0px none;}
.parrilla_head .nav .selbox ul.prog {line-height: 3em;}
.parrilla_head .nav .selbox ul.prog li{font-family: Roboto, arial, sans-serif;display:inline; font-size:100%; color:#333; padding:1.3rem 1.2rem .3rem 1.2rem; margin:0px .5rem;position:relative; top:3px;}

.parrilla_head .nav .selbox ul.prog li.infor {border-bottom:.5rem solid rgba(255, 0, 24, 0.4);}
.parrilla_head .nav .selbox ul.prog li.magaz {border-bottom:.5rem solid rgba(12, 33, 187, 0.4);}
.parrilla_head .nav .selbox ul.prog li.music {border-bottom:.5rem solid rgba(136, 45, 197, 0.4);}
.parrilla_head .nav .selbox ul.prog li.depor {border-bottom:.5rem solid rgba(4, 111, 54, 0.4);}
.parrilla_head .nav .selbox ul.prog li.docum {border-bottom:.5rem solid rgba(255, 202, 0, 0.4);}
.parrilla_head .nav .selbox ul.prog li.cienc {border-bottom:.5rem solid rgba(0, 133, 255, 0.4);}
.parrilla_head .nav .selbox ul.prog li.cultu {border-bottom:.5rem solid #b9676f;}
.parrilla_head .nav .selbox ul.prog li.infan {border-bottom:.5rem solid rgba(255, 0, 210, 0.4);}
.parrilla_head .nav .selbox ul.prog li.otros {border-bottom:.5rem solid rgba(245, 107, 13, 0.4);}

#parrilla_slide .items .infor {background-color:rgba(197, 20, 36, 0.5);}
#parrilla_slide .items .magaz {background-color:rgba(12, 33, 187, 0.4);}
#parrilla_slide .items .music {background-color:rgba(136, 45, 197, 0.4);}
#parrilla_slide .items .depor {background-color:rgba(4, 111, 54, 0.4);}
#parrilla_slide .items .docum {background-color:rgba(255, 202, 0, 0.4);}
#parrilla_slide .items .cienc {background-color:rgba(0, 133, 255, 0.4);}
#parrilla_slide .items .cultu {background-color:#b9676f;}
#parrilla_slide .items .infan {background-color:rgba(255, 0, 210, 0.4);}
#parrilla_slide .items .otros {background-color:rgba(245, 107, 13, 0.4);}

.parrilla_head .nav .selbox{border:none;}

/*items programacion*/
ul.items.CRN_RADIO5 {padding: 0 4rem;}

#parrilla_slide .items li {display: block;height: 3rem;margin: .2rem .2rem 0 0;padding: .2rem;width:100%!important;}

#parrilla_slide .items li a {background: transparent;display: inline-block;height: auto;padding-top: 0;width: 90%;transition: all .2s;}
#parrilla_slide .items li a:hover {margin-top: -.4rem;text-decoration: none;}

/*la hora de inicio va fuera del enlace por sugerencia de SEO*/
#parrilla_slide .items li .hour,#parrilla_slide .items li strong {font-size:110%;line-height:150%; }
#parrilla_slide .items li .hour {color:#333;font-weight:bold;width:auto;font-size: 1.6rem!important;float: left;}
#parrilla_slide .items li strong {position:relative;color:#333;font-family: Roboto, arial, sans-serif;}
#parrilla_slide .items li em {float: left; width: 100%; margin-top:3px; font-style:normal; color:#000;}

/*positioning*/
#channels {display: none;}
#parrilla_slide,
#parrilla_slide ul,#schedule,
#programacion,
#parrilla_slide .items li {position:relative;}
#channels, #parrilla_slide .date, .hores, #parrilla_slide .nav_parrilla li, #parrilla_slide .pointer, #parrilla_slide .needle {}

#parrilla_slide .nav_parrilla {left:0;}
#parrilla_slide .nav_parrilla .der {right:0;}
#parrilla_slide .nav_parrilla .izq {right:89.4em; }
#parrilla_slide .items li .hour,#parrilla_slide .items li strong {background:transparent;padding: .2rem;font-size: 1.8rem;display: inline-block;color:#222;}

#parrilla_slide .pointer {top:0;}
#parrilla_slide .needle {top:3.2em;left:50%;}
.parrilla_bottom {text-align: right;width: 60%;display: inline-block;}
.parrilla_bottom a {text-decoration:none;background-color: #f56b0d;display:inline-block;padding:.4rem .8rem;color:#fff;text-transform:uppercase;transition: all .2s;} 
#channels,#parrilla_slide .date,#parrilla_slide .nav_parrilla {z-index:5;text-align: center;}
#parrilla_slide .pointer {z-index:4;-webkit-border-radius: 0.4em; -moz-border-radius: 0.4em; border-radius: 0.4em; background-image:none!important;}

div#back {z-index: 99!important;}
.parrilla_bottom span {font-family: Roboto, arial,sans-serif;text-decoration: none;}

span.cat.hddn {display: none;}
#programacion {font-family: sans-serif;}
#parrilla_slide .items h3 {margin: 0;}
div#parrilla_slide ul strong {font-size: 3rem;color: #4b4b4b;}

/*footer*/
.footer span.ghost, #fecparr_r5_es_manana {font-family: Roboto, arial,sans-serif;font-size: 1rem;line-height: 2rem;vertical-align: bottom;color: #444;}

.footer a {width: 100%;color: #737578;text-decoration: none;}

.footer .container .blindBox ul li a {text-decoration: none;}
.footer  ul {list-style: none;}
.footer .container .blindBox ul li span, .footer .container .endBox span, .footer .container .endBox ul li span {font-family: 'Roboto','Arial',sans-serif;font-weight: 700;font-style: normal;}

@media all and (max-width:880px){
.parrilla_head .nav .selbox ul.prog {padding:1rem;}
.parrilla_head .nav .selbox ul.prog li strong{font-size:1.2rem;}
}